The authors developed a new enzymatic-colorimetric rapid method for testing milk for residues of organophosphorous insecticides. The test is based on the colour reaction of indoxyl acetate with the esterase of the OROSERAN (Dessau) horse serum which is inhibited by organophosphorous insecticides. Calibration curves were established for Trichlorphon and Dichlorphos (DDVP). The limit of detection lies at 0.02 mg/kg. The time actually needed per sample is about 15 min. The result is obtained within 90 min. Since this procedure requires no clean-up operations, it is labour-saving compared to other thin-layer or gas chromatographic methods. It may be recommended as a screening test for the detection of organophosphorous insecticides in milk samples. 相似文献

Objective: These studies investigated whether non-demented ALS patients display impairments on tests of emotional decision making and social and emotional cognition, sensitive to frontal variant Frontotemporal Dementia (fvFTD). Previous studies have shown predominant executive dysfunction and dorsolateral prefrontal involvement in ALS, but evidence of other prefrontal dysfunction implicated in fvFTD is sparse. Method: In Study A, 19 ALS patients and 20 healthy controls undertook a test of affective decision making, modified Iowa Gambling Task (IGT). Behavioral measures included the Frontal Systems Behavior Scale. In Study B, 14 ALS patients and 20 controls undertook tests of social and emotional cognition (Judgment of Preference based on eye gaze, the Mind in the Eyes, recognition of Facial Expressions of Emotion). Results: In Study A, ALS patients demonstrated a significantly different performance profile from healthy controls on the IGT and did not learn to avoid the disadvantageous stimuli (Block 3, d = 0.60, Block 4 days = 0.68). Behavior ratings showed increased apathy from premorbid levels. In Study B, ALS patients were impaired on attentionally demanding (d = 3.12) and undemanding (d = 7.52) conditions of the Judgment of Preference task, despite many showing intact executive functions. A smaller subset showed impaired emotion recognition. Behavior change was also evident. Conclusions: The findings reveal a Theory of Mind deficit on a simple test that was dissociated from the presence of executive dysfunction and suggests a profile of cognitive and behavioral dysfunction indicative of a subclinical fvFTD syndrome. The relative contribution of prefrontal pathways to the cognitive profile in ALS is considered. (PsycINFO Database Record (c) 2010 APA, all rights reserved) 相似文献

Inorganic–organic hybrid materials prepared from zirconium oxo‐clusters and 2‐hydroxyethyl methacrylate

This article describes the preparation and characterization of hybrid materials obtained from the polymerization of vinyl‐substituted zirconium oxo‐clusters [Zr6O4(OH)4(OOCCH2CHCH2)12(n‐PrOH)]2·4(CH2CHCH2COOH) (Zr12) and 2‐hydroxyethyl methacrylate (HEMA). The zirconium oxo‐clusters serve as cross‐linking agents, forming a 3D network by means of the copolymerization of their vinylic ligands with HEMA. To optimize the conditions for cross‐linking, the polymerization was monitored with a differential scanning calorimeter. The resulting hybrid materials were also characterized using thermo‐mechanical techniques. There was evidence not only of a greater rigidity above Tg, but also of a better thermal stability for several hybrid formulations than for simple poly‐2‐hydroxyethyl methacrylate. After immersion in water, the hybrids containing 20 or 60% w/w zirconium oxo‐clusters also showed a stable behavior with an equilibrium swelling at about 27 and 18% w/w of water, respectively. © 2014 Wiley Periodicals, Inc. Railway networks are operated more and more at capacity margins, schedules are becoming more susceptible to disturbances, and delays propagate and hamper the service level experienced by the customers. As a consequence railway traffic management is becoming increasingly challenging, thus motivating the development of computer-aided systems. This paper proposes a dispatching assistant in the form of a model predictive control framework for a complex central railway station area. The closed-loop discrete-time system suggests rescheduling trains according to solutions of a binary linear optimization model. The model assigns precomputed blocking-stairways to trains while respecting resource-based clique constraints, connection constraints, platform related constraints and consistency constraints with the objective of maximizing customer satisfaction. In collaboration with the Swiss Federal Railways (SBB), the approach was successfully applied for an operational day at the central railway station area Berne, Switzerland. The model is capable of considering many alternative routing possibilities and departure timings, a potential of our approach, which can also be deduced from computational results. 相似文献

In this work, according to the concept of ‘area’ on the v–i plane, a new approach called swept area theory, under both nonlinear continuous and discontinuous conditions, is developed. Novel conservative functions, such as area velocity and closed area over time (CAT), involved in this theory, are proposed. An analysis is carried out, by means of these functions, over nonlinear R, L, and C elements and over the ideal switch. In addition, jump discontinuities are discussed in detail. The CAT is related to the harmonic reactive powers and under sinusoidal steady state becomes proportional to the classical reactive power. A balance rule concerning harmonic reactive powers over nonlinear resistor under continuous conditions is obtained and discussed as a novel interesting result. This aspect impacts on a possible expanded definition of reactive power under distorted conditions. Thanks to the switching power, a novel quantitative relation between hard‐switching commutations and CAT is obtained, with both theoretical and applicative relevance. More explanation is presented through a demonstration that shows how an ideal switch and power converters can become sources of reactive power. Issues of principle regarding the ideal switch model with respect to the real one are another important result of this work. Copyright © 2015 John Wiley & Sons, Ltd. 相似文献

Proper management of Information Technology (IT) resources and services has become imperative for the success of modern organizations. The IT Infrastructure Library (ITIL) represents, in this context, the most widely accepted framework to help achieve this end. Among the processes that compose ITIL, change management has an important role in defining best practices and processes for the efficient and prompt handling of IT changes. In practice, however, such changes are usually described and documented in an ad hoc fashion, due to the lack of proper support to assist the design process. This hampers knowledge acquired when specifying, planning, and carrying out previous changes to be reused in subsequent requests, even though such reuse may result in fewer incidents and faster specification of change plans. To address this problem, in this paper we present a conceptual solution to support the design and planning of IT changes and explore the concept of change templates as a mechanism to formalize, preserve, and (re)use knowledge in the specification of (recurrent and similar) IT changes. To prove concept and technical feasibility of the proposed solution, we have developed a prototypical implementation of a change management system called ChangeLedge and used it to carry out a set of experiments, considering typical IT changes. The results obtained indicate the effectiveness and efficiency of the system, which is able to generate accurate and actionable change plans in substantially less time than would be spent by a skilled human operator. 相似文献

The ability of the Model 3320 aerodynamic particle sizer (APS) to make accurate mass-weighted size distribution measurements was investigated. Significant errors were observed in APS size distribution measurements with measured mass median aerodynamic diameters (MMADs) as much as 17 times higher than from cascade impactor measurements. Analysis of APS correlated time-of-flight and light scattering data indicated that the MMAD distortions were due to a few anomalous large particle measurements (~0.1% of the total measurements) with surprisingly low scattered light. Computational fluid dynamics modeling indicated that these anomalous measurements were due to particles that deviated from the intended aerosol pathway and recirculated through the APS measurement volume at low velocities leading to erroneous large particle measurements. A technique for removing erroneous measurements based on correlated aerodynamic diameter and light scattering values is presented. When this technique was used, APS and cascade impactor size distribution measurements agreed well. 相似文献

A new zirconium nano building block (ZrNBB) was prepared by the reaction of Zirconium tetrapropoxide with 3‐butynoic acid in an alkoxide/acid at a 1 : 3 or 1 : 6 molar ratio. The complex was characterized by FTIR, 1H‐NMR and 13C‐NMR spectroscopy, thermogravimetric analysis, differential scanning calorimetry, energy‐dispersive X‐ray analysis, and elementary analysis. A spontaneous alkyne‐to‐allene isomerization process was observed for ZrNBB. A bulk sample was also prepared and analyzed via dynamical mechanical spectroscopy in compression mode. The zirconium complex was then embedded in a polymeric matrix by radical copolymerization with vinyl trimethoxysilane. The inorganic–organic hybrid material was chemically and thermally stable. The shear storage modulus and loss modulus were measured to determine the mechanical properties of the material. The preliminary results are presented. © 2011 Wiley Periodicals, Inc.
